concuss

[US]/kən'kʌs/
[UK]/kən'kʌs/
Frequency: Very High

Translation

vt. to cause a violent shaking or jarring in (someone or something)
Word Forms
Present Participleconcussing
Past Tenseconcussed
Third Person Singularconcusses
Past Participleconcussed
